From the page: In 2001, George did me a solid when he accepted the part of the orally fixated hitchhiker who knew exactly how to get a ride in Jay and Silent Bob Strike Back. When he wrapped his scene in that flick, I thanked him for making the time, and he said, Just do me a favor: Write me my dream role one day. When I inquired what that'd be, he offered, I wanna play a priest who strangles children.
